Where Is Tsum Valley?
Tsum Valley is in the northern part of Nepal, inside the Manaslu region. It is surrounded by high mountains and green hills. The valley is protected, which means special rules help keep it clean and safe.

Life in the Villages
Villages in Tsum Valley are small and peaceful. Houses are made of stone and wood. People grow crops, take care of animals, and help one another.
Many villages have old monasteries. Monks pray there every day. Colorful prayer flags hang near homes and temples. These flags show peace and kindness.

Why a Guide Is Needed
Tsum Valley is a restricted area. This means visitors must follow special rules to protect the valley and its culture. Walking with a guide helps people stay on the correct path and understand local life.
